You can add additional What Else To Do? actions to a content rule. For example, you might want to Generate an Inform to notify an administrator.
The Generate an Inform action sends a notification email to specified recipients to inform them of the actions taken during
To configure a Generate an Inform action:
Specify the conditions required for the inform to be sent:
Select an inform from a list of available templates and customize the content.
To create a new inform template, select (Create a new inform) from the drop-down menu and Save your changes. The inform is displayed as Using the template: 'Inform for [content rule name]'. Click the template name to modify the Inform. |
Specify the recipients who will receive the inform message:
Message Originator: The sender of the original message.

The sender's manager: The manager of the person who sent the original message.
Select Consolidate informs for the same message ID to consolidate multiple Inform notifications.
